clapet — meaning in English

French → English · translate English → French instead

English meaning

  • trap noun A device designed to catch or kill an animal.
  • valve noun A device that controls or directs the flow of liquid or gas through a pipe or opening.

Senses

clapet is used for these senses in English:

  • trap (slang) A person's mouth.
  • valve A device that controls the flow of a gas or fluid through a space, such as a pipe, manifold, or plenum.
